When it comes to training these large guard dogs, a strong and consistent approach is key. Here are some basic tips to help you effectively train your Presa Canario.

1. Start Early:

Training should begin as soon as you bring your Presa Canario puppy home. Early socialization is crucial to ensure they grow up to be well-mannered and balanced dogs. Expose them to different environments, people, and animals to help them become comfortable and confident in various situations.

2. Establish Leadership:

Presa Canarios are naturally dominant and have a strong protective instinct. It’s essential to establish yourself as the pack leader from the beginning. Be firm, consistent, and set clear boundaries. They need to understand that you are in control and that they can trust and respect your commands.

3. Positive Reinforcement:

Positive reinforcement is the most effective training method for Presa Canarios. Rewarding good behavior with treats, praise, or playtime is essential. They respond well to positive reinforcement and are eager to please their owners. Use treats or toys as motivators during training sessions, and praise and reward them when they exhibit the desired behavior.

4. Consistency is Key:

Consistency is crucial in training large guard dogs like Presa Canarios. Use the same commands consistently and ensure everyone in the household is on the same page. If you use different words or gestures for the same command, it can confuse the dog and hinder their learning process. Consistency fosters clarity and encourages obedience.

5. Obedience Training:

Obedience training is essential for Presa Canarios as it strengthens the bond between you and your dog and promotes good behavior. Teach them basic commands like “sit,” “stay,” “down,” and “come.” Remember to use positive reinforcement during these training sessions to make it more enjoyable for them. Gradually increase the difficulty level as they master each command.

6. Leash Training:

Due to their size and strength, leash training is crucial for Presa Canarios. Start by introducing them to a collar or harness and let them get comfortable with it before attaching the leash. Begin with short, controlled walks, and gradually increase the distance. Reward them for walking calmly beside you and discourage pulling or lunging behavior.

7. Socialization:

Socialization is an integral part of training any dog, and Presa Canarios are no exception. Expose them to different people, animals, and environments, ensuring positive experiences. This helps them become well-rounded and reduces the likelihood of fear or aggression towards strangers or other animals. Dog parks, training classes, and controlled playdates can aid in their social development.

8. Professional Help:

If you are unsure about training a large guard dog like a Presa Canario, it’s always wise to seek professional help. A professional dog trainer experienced in working with large breeds can guide you through the training process and address any specific behavior issues you might encounter. They can offer personalized advice tailored to your dog’s needs.

9. Mental Stimulation:

Presa Canarios are intelligent dogs that require mental stimulation to prevent boredom and destructive behavior. Incorporate interactive games, puzzle toys, and obedience training into their routine to keep their minds engaged. Engaging in regular obedience training and teaching them new tricks can also help stimulate their minds and build a stronger bond with you.

10. Patience and Persistence:

Training a Presa Canario requires patience and persistence. Remember that they are a strong-willed breed, and progress may not always be linear. Stay calm, consistent, and positive throughout the training journey. With time, dedication, and love, your Presa Canario will become a well-behaved and obedient companion.
